Why Traditional Wheels Fail Under Stress

Standard abrasive wheels often degrade rapidly when exposed to continuous heat, high cutting forces, and thermal shock. In one case study from a precision automotive parts supplier in Germany, conventional CBN wheels lasted only 4–6 hours before requiring reconditioning—a bottleneck that reduced throughput by 18%. The root cause? Poor heat dissipation and inconsistent grain bonding under sustained load.

How to Match Tool Specifications to Your Process

When choosing a brazed diamond grinding tool, consider:

  1. Diameter & Thickness: Larger diameters (e.g., 150mm+) offer more contact area and smoother cuts but require higher spindle torque.
  2. Grain Size: Fine grains (30–60 mesh) for finishing; coarse (12–30 mesh) for roughing.
  3. Concentration Level: 30–45% for heavy-duty grinding; 20–30% for precision work.

Pro Tip: Always conduct a 2-hour trial run at 70% of your target RPM before full-scale implementation. It helps identify any vibration issues or premature wear patterns early.
